One of the many problems when it comes to sharing broadband connection is the distribution of bandwidth, I’m having a tough time tweaking my wireless router settings, and things are made worst when the internet is shared between 8 people in the house.

I’ve tried searching for a solution and ways to distribute the broadband bandwidth and finally found out that the only way to distribute the broadband bandwidth equally among everyone is non other than the use of small-office broadband router, it’s the hardware that makes the difference. A good wireless router has the ability to set up a Virtual Private Networking with user ID and password for each individual, each individual can be allocated a certain amount of bandwidth, and a good router has the ability to block all bittorrent ports.
